Angelina Jolie‘s directorial debut, In the Land of Blood and Honey has a trailer as FilmDistrict has already set up a December 23 release date. It was a film that was, quite frankly, easy to forget considering we haven’t seen any stills and this is the first piece of marketing that’s arrived and even it comes via YouTube rather than a release through the normal channels.

Not only directed by, but written by Angelina Jolie, In the Land of Blood and Honey is set against the backdrop of the Bosnian War in the ’90s and illustrates the consequences of the lack of political will to intervene in a society stricken with conflict. The story would appear to center on the love story between a Muslim woman and a Serbian man. Zana Marjanovic (Paycheck), Rade Serbedzija (X-Men: First Class) and Goran Kostic (Taken) star.
